15-year plan to convert Reliance into new energy company
Billionaire Mukesh Ambani’s Reliance Industries Ltd has a 15-year vision to build itself as a new energy company that aims to recycle CO2, create value from plastic waste and has an optimal mix of clean and affordable energy, analysts said.
While the oil-to-chemical conglomerate has in recent times seen a focus on the consumer business, RIL’s core oil-to-chemical (O2C) business is well placed to generate sustained free cash flow, BofA Securities said in a report.
“Until demand normalises, RIL is looking to maximise throughput, focus on the cost by leveraging deep petrochemical integration and continue to focus on domestic fuel marketing,” it said.
